Don't take it the wrong way, but I sorta agree with the toman at David's (even though I abhor that place)...I went dress shopping with a particular look in mind - A-line, NO beading/pearls/etc, NO lace. I wound up with a totally different look, after having tried on 50 dresses in the style I was intent on buying.

the thing is, what we picture in our mind and what actually looks and feels good on us, can sometimes be 2 very different things.

My advice - and do with it as you wish - would be to call for appointments in advance...clip a ton of pictures of dresses that you love...bring some water and go to town!

Best of luck to you...

PS - I found 'the' dress on my own too...I went back this weekend with 2 BMs and my stepmom to buy it...it was about the 60th dress I tried on.
